Dark Mode

Skip to content

Navigation Menu

Sign in
Appearance settings

Search code, repositories, users, issues, pull requests...

Provide feedback

We read every piece of feedback, and take your input very seriously.

Saved searches

Use saved searches to filter your results more quickly

Sign up
Appearance settings

abbasmzs/conehead

Repository files navigation

conehead

A collapsed-cone convolution radiotherapy dose calculation algorithm written in Python/Cython.

This project is currently in early experimental development. Expect the code to change dramatically over the coming months.

Inspiration has been drawn from Cho et al (2012) and Yang et al (2002).

Early development milestones:

  • Linac geometry
  • Water phantom
  • Point source
  • Annular primary collimator source
  • Exponential filter scatter source
  • Voxel blocking (Jaws, MLC)
  • Fluence calculation
  • TERMA calculation
  • Kernel calculated (EDKnrc)
  • Kernel convolution
  • Kernel tilting
  • Horn tuning factor
  • Square fields
  • Parse DICOM RT plan files (3DCRT , IMRT/VMAT)
  • Import CT images
  • Support density overrides
  • Option to optimise for out-of-field dosimetry

About

A collapsed-cone convolution radiotherapy dose calculation algorithm

Topics

Resources

Readme

License

MIT license

Stars

Watchers

Forks

Releases

No releases published

Packages

Contributors

Languages

  • Jupyter Notebook 63.5%
  • Python 32.6%
  • Cython 3.9%